Transaction 988ae70ce947a33308156854786b58e90c581168f09388cd8c179af51946e1a6
1 Input
2 Outputs
- 988ae70ce947a33308156854786b58e90c581168f09388cd8c179af51946e1a6:0
- 988ae70ce947a33308156854786b58e90c581168f09388cd8c179af51946e1a6:1
value 3797123
address 1FBr2rJPdxjX7WsVyrpYAMi8JiCJuRG1HU
value 9545499
address 39Mro9DeMHReMtAxkwToKV98smpG4nukYz